History
Semiahmoo Secondary was built in the city of White Rock in the late 1930s, becoming the area's first secondary school. The former building, now cleared, stood where White Rock Elementary School stands today. When White Rock Junior Secondary was built in 1961 on Oxford Street, Semiahmoo was officially renamed Semiahmoo Senior Secondary. A severe classroom shortage in the 1980s, started by a fire in White Rock Junior Secondary, prompted an effort by the provincial ministry of education to expand educational facilities in South Surrey. In 1990, Semiahmoo was transferred to the newly renovated and expanded White Rock Junior facilities, officially becoming Semiahmoo High School.
